#a28566 - Water Wheel color

This warm, muted tan leans toward soft caramel with a gentle golden-brown core and subtle gray undertones. It reads as an earthy, vintage neutral—cozy and slightly weathered rather than bright or saturated. Imagine sun-faded leather, dried grasses, and aged wood: comforting and versatile. It pairs beautifully with deep navy, olive green, cream, or rust for layered, autumnal palettes, and works well in interiors, textiles, and product finishes where a restrained, natural elegance is desired.

color #a28566

#a28566 color RGB value is 162, 133, 102, and the CMYK value is 0.00, 0.179, 0.370, 0.365. Alternative names for that color are: water wheel, tan, sandal, beaver, orange.
